The LWN Penguin Gallery

Here is a collection of the interesting penguins we have been able to find out there on the net. Note that we're not trying to gather up every occurence of a penguin somewhere - the idea here is to catalog the "derivative" penguins that are on the loose. Where it all began

The classic Linux penguin was originally the creation of Larry Ewing; see his penguin page to see how he used the Gimp to create the creature which we now see all over the net. You can also find some historical information on PenguinPower.com.
